Anyone have a Stag upper and a Stag 22 conversion kit they could share their experiences with?

Or for "comparison" any other brand of upper and conversion kit.

I've done some looking around and found a couple of manufacturers of the kits in the $129 range. Stag is in the $220 range but is stainless where the others are not. Stainless was adding another $70 to those brands which bring it more into line with the Stag and there are a few dealers selling the Stags for a bit less.

Reviews I've read have not been very favorable to the non-Stag conversion kits stating there is an issue with jamming every few rounds, a problem not shared by the Stag kit in a Stag upper. The only issue with the Stag was that it may not work with Remington 22LR ammo (instructions from the factory) which I'm assuming is more with the ammo than the kit.
